1. Vitamin C

Vitamin C isn’t just vital for overall health, but it’s an effective remedy for the presence of dental bacteria since its antioxidant properties fight infection and help build strong gums, as per Dr. Louie who advises that patients who have bleeding gums should think about taking an Vitamin C supplements.

Vitamin C is an essential water-soluble vitamin that is found in both vegetables and fruits. To get the most health benefits from it the recommended intake is at minimum 75 mg of Vitamin C every day.

However, it is essential to be aware that the most effective method to increase your intake of vitamin C is through fresh produce such as carrots, spinach and oranges. The foods that do not contain added sugar are likely to have greater natural sources of this essential nutrient, so making sure you include these foods in your meals and snacks is beneficial.

A diet that is rich in Vitamin C is the best method to protect yourself from dental problems. Furthermore, this type of diet boosts your immune system as it helps fight off infections.

Vitamin C’s antioxidant properties are necessary for the production of collagen, which is essential to keep periodontal structures in good shape, such as gingiva, periodontal ligament and cementum as well as alveolar bone. Additionally Vitamin C has the capacity to decrease inflammation in the mouth and aid in periodontal tissue healing.

3. Zinc

Zinc is an essential mineral that is essential for maintaining good dental health. It is beneficial for many reasons like preventing gum disease.

It protects against inflammation and cell membrane disruption caused by bacteria which cause gingivitis. Additionally, it blocks the production of hydrogen peroxide which can cause irritation to the mouth when inhaled.

Zinc is abundant in the dental hard tissues including dental enamel. Your enamel is composed of calcium hydroxyapatite, which has crystal structure that zinc assists in creating. This makes your tooth enamel harder and more resistant dental caries.

Zinc toothpaste is proven scientifically to reduce plaque and calculus formation, protecting tooth enamel from damage and loss. It also reduces acid production and promote remineralization – strengthening enamel.

Furthermore, it aids in reducing the smell caused due to volatile sulfur compounds (VSCs) within your mouth. This smell develops when bacteria consume food particles in your mouth, and then release the gas.
